(全文共计986字)
技术背景与开发定位 在Web3.0时代背景下,明星个人数字形象展示平台正经历从静态页面向动态交互的转型,本文聚焦Flash技术构建的明星个人网站源码开发,重点解析如何通过矢量动画、交互设计、数据可视化等技术手段,打造具有艺术表现力与商业价值的数字形象载体,相较于传统HTML5方案,Flash技术凭借其成熟的矢量渲染引擎和丰富动画库,在复杂场景表现上仍具独特优势。
图片来源于网络,如有侵权联系删除
技术架构设计
系统架构图 采用MVC分层架构模式,包含:
- presentation层:AS3动画引擎+XML数据驱动
- model层:XML数据模型+数据库接口
- view层:矢量图形渲染+粒子系统
- control层:事件响应逻辑+状态管理
核心组件解析
- 动态导航系统:基于骨骼动画的菜单交互,支持触控手势识别
- 3D虚拟形象:Cascading Particles粒子系统实现动态光影效果
- 数据可视化层:使用Flşı charts实现粉丝增长曲线动态展示
- 多媒体集成:支持H.264视频流媒体嵌入与实时弹幕互动
关键技术实现
动态加载机制 开发基于XML DOM的异步资源加载框架,实现:
- 动态皮肤切换(JSON配置文件驱动)
- 流媒体视频缓冲优化(自适应码率控制)
- 动态数据绑定(E4X语法实现)
交互逻辑设计
- 骨骼动画控制:通过Spine JSON文件实现2D角色动画
- 多点触控支持:开发基于Flash Player 12的多点坐标解析器
- 传感器集成:模拟移动端陀螺仪数据传递(需硬件兼容)
性能优化方案
- 分帧加载技术:将动画拆分为12帧独立资源
- GPU加速渲染:启用Flash Player的硬件加速模式
- 内存管理:开发自动回收废弃对象的智能GC机制
商业应用场景
- 影视宣发平台:动态花絮展示+实时互动投票系统
- 音乐专辑发布:3D歌词动画+社交分享组件
- 虚拟演唱会:基于WebGL的跨平台直播推流方案
- 商业代言展示:产品3D建模+AR场景模拟
开发流程规范
需求分析阶段
- 制定用户画像:核心受众为18-35岁Z世代粉丝群体
- 确定KPI指标:页面加载时间<2秒,互动响应延迟<0.3s
- 制定兼容性方案:Flash Player 11.3+版本支持矩阵
开发实施阶段
图片来源于网络,如有侵权联系删除
- 采用Git进行版本控制,配置多分支开发策略
- 建立自动化测试环境:包含12类单元测试用例
- 实施持续集成:每日构建生成SWF文件包
部署运维方案
- CDN加速分发:采用Edgecast全球节点网络
- 数据监控体系:集成Google Analytics+自定义日志分析
- 安全防护机制:实施SWF文件沙箱隔离与反爬虫策略
行业趋势与挑战
技术演进方向
- HTML5 Canvas与WebGL的混合渲染方案
- WebAssembly在Flash替代方案中的实践
- 区块链技术的数字版权认证集成
开发者挑战
- 人才断层:具备Flash开发经验的工程师减少67%(2023年行业报告)
- 性能瓶颈:复杂动画场景下的内存泄漏问题
- 兼容性问题:移动端Flash支持逐渐退出历史舞台
商业化路径
- 开发SaaS平台:提供标准化模板+定制开发服务
- 构建数字资产库:将动画资源转化为NFT数字藏品
- 建立开发者生态:开放API接口吸引第三方开发者
典型案例分析 以某顶流明星官网改版项目为例:
- 技术栈:Flash Player 12 + ActionScript 3.0 + XML
- 核心功能:360°全息形象展示(占用内存优化至28MB)
- 性能指标:平均加载时间1.8秒(优化前3.5秒)
- 商业价值:带动周边产品销量提升42%,社交媒体互动量增长3倍
未来展望 随着Web3.0技术发展,Flash源码开发正向混合架构转型,建议开发者:
- 建立技术储备库:持续跟踪WebAssembly、WebGL3.0等新技术
- 构建数字资产体系:将现有Flash作品转化为可交互的3D数字资产
- 开发跨平台工具链:创建Flash到HTML5的自动化转换插件
- 布局元宇宙场景:开发基于Flash引擎的虚拟空间交互组件
本源码体系通过模块化架构设计,实现了艺术表现与技术实现的完美平衡,开发者可根据具体需求选择组件进行组合,在保证技术先进性的同时,有效控制开发成本,随着数字内容产业的持续升级,具备复合型技术能力的开发团队将在明星数字形象构建领域占据重要地位。
(本文数据来源:Adobe官方技术白皮书、中国网络视听发展研究报告2023、Gartner技术成熟度曲线分析)
标签: #明星个人flash网站源码
评论列表